2007 Ford Ka vs. 2007 Ford Focus

To start off, both 2007 Ford Ka and 2007 Ford Focus were released in the same year (2007).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 1,599 cc (4 cylinders), 2007 Ford Ka is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Ford Focus (108 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 14 more horse power than 2007 Ford Ka. (94 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Ford Focus should accelerate faster than 2007 Ford Ka.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Ford Focus weights approximately 175 kg more than 2007 Ford Ka.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Ford Focus (240 Nm @ 1750 RPM) has 104 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 Ford Ka. (136 Nm @ 4250 RPM). This means 2007 Ford Focus will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 Ford Ka.

Compare all specifications:

2007 Ford Ka 2007 Ford Focus
Make Ford Ford
Model Ka Focus
Year Released 2007 2007
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1599 cc 1560 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 94 HP 108 HP
Engine RPM 5500 RPM 4000 RPM
Torque 136 Nm 240 Nm
Torque RPM 4250 RPM 1750 RPM
Engine Bore Size 82.1 mm 73 mm
Engine Stroke Size 75.5 mm 88 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line - Premium Diesel
Top Speed 173 km/hour 188 km/hour
Acceleration 0-100mph 12.1 seconds 11.1 seconds
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1136 kg 1311 kg
Vehicle Length 3660 mm 4460 mm
Vehicle Width 1690 mm 1710 mm
Vehicle Height 1350 mm 1540 mm
Wheelbase Size 2460 mm 2620 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 7.9 L/100km 4.8 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 40 L 55 L
